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ors that shift the price include the square footage of the area, the complexity of your design, and the type of materials you choose, such as natural stone versus concrete pavers. Labor costs fluctuate based on site accessibility and the amount of grading or drainage work required before planting begins.

White rocks offer a clean, modern look for landscaping in Pomona, ideal for drought-tolerant gardens and pathways. They reflect light, making spaces feel brighter. However, they can get hot in direct sun and may require occasional cleaning to maintain their appearance. They also don't provide the same soil-enriching benefits as organic mulches. A landscape rake is useful in Pomona for preparing soil beds, spreading gravel evenly, or clearing debris from lawns and garden areas. It's essential for leveling ground before planting or laying sod. For large-scale projects or precise grading, professional landscaping services are highly recommended.
